本文分两部分:一是TPWallet最新版中安全、可靠地卖出PIG代币的操作要点;二是围绕“创新数据管理、支付审计、防故障注入、弹性云计算、合约导出与透明度”的系统级设计与建议。
一、在TPWallet里卖PIG的步骤(通用、安全指引)
1) 确认网络与合约:先在区块浏览器(如BscScan/ETHScan)核实PIG代币合约地址、持有量与流动性池地址,确认代币不是骗币或被添加了高权限税费。建议先搜索合约是否已验证源码与审计报告。

2) 在钱包里添加自定义代币:复制合约地址到TPWallet的“添加代币”,确认符号与小数位正确。
3) 做小额试单:先用小额PIG做一次卖出,确认价格、滑点与手续费,以免大额交易被吃单或滑点过大。
4) 选择交易对与路由:若TPWallet内置Swap,确认使用的DEX(如PancakeSwap、Uniswap)路由,并比较不同路由的预估价与滑点。
5) 批准与卖出:先在钱包内执行“Approve”给交易合约(只对首次交互),然后发起Swap,设置合理滑点(根据流动性,一般0.5%-3%或更高视情况),设置合适的GAS或使用快速模式以避免交易被卡住。
6) 交易确认与查看回执:通过区块浏览器查看交易状态、实际成交量与手续费,导出交易哈希与收据用于审计。
7) 风险与退出:若遇到交易失败或价格剧烈滑动,可使用交易替换(replace-by-fee)或取消待定交易;遇到合约风险立即转移剩余资产至安全地址。
二、系统级要点与实现建议
1) 创新数据管理:将用户交易、授权与链上事件分层存储——原始链上事件(不可更改)与处理后业务数据(加密索引)。使用时间序列数据库记录交易状态,采用分区与冷/热存储策略,保证查询效率与长期溯源。加密私密字段(私钥永不存储)、使用KMS管理密钥、细粒度访问控制与审计日志。
2) 支付审计:为每笔卖出生成不可篡改的审计条目(txHash、from/to、amount、路由、手续费、时间戳)。支持批量对账、异常识别(例如滑点突增、反常频次)并导出CSV/JSON供合规与财务检视。提供Webhook或事件流(Kafka)与第三方SIEM集成。
3) 防故障注入:在交易链路加入幂等检查、模拟执行(eth_call/simulate)以提前检测revert或高失败率;对关键路径实现限流、熔断与回退策略;对外部RPC或DEX接口实现超时与重试机制,并把重试策略记录到审计日志中。
4) 弹性云计算系统:多区域、多提供商部署RPC代理与中间层,前端与任务处理采用容器化与自动扩缩容(Kubernetes),用负载均衡与服务发现切换故障节点。对链数据同步使用容错节点(多个归档/索引节点),保证在单点故障时迅速切换。
5) 合约导出与透明度:提供一键导出功能:ABI、合约地址、已验证源码链接、交易哈希与审计证明(签名时间戳)。鼓励用户与项目方在区块浏览器验证源码、发布审计报告与多重签名治理信息。所有导出文档应包含机器可读格式(JSON/ABI)与人类可读摘要。
三、实践建议与安全提示

- 先做小额试验;谨防高滑点与低流动性导致巨大损失。
- 不在不信任的Wi‑Fi环境下操作,私钥及助记词绝不外泄。
- 使用多RPC节点与节点池以避免单点延迟或被故障注入误导价格。
- 对于企业级应用,引入第三方审计与多签托管,保存完整审计链供合规和争议处理。
结语:在TPWallet里卖PIG本身是常见的去中心化交易行为,但要把单次操作的安全性与长期系统级可靠性结合起来——从链上合约验证、试单与滑点控制,到数据加密存储、详细支付审计、防故障注入策略与弹性云部署,以及合约与审计信息的透明导出,才能既保护用户资产又满足合规与可追溯性需求。
评论
SkyWalker
讲得很全面,试单和滑点部分太实用,谢谢!
小橘子
合约导出和审计导出这段我正需要,能否再多写些工具推荐?
TokenHunter
关于防故障注入,能否给出模拟脚本或常用测试场景?很想看实操。
林晓雨
多RPC和弹性云的建议很好,尤其是企业级部署,应对故障更稳妥。